Join us to discuss GOOD NIGHT, IRENE by Luis Alberto Urrea. For a copy of the book and the Zoom link, contact Andrea Larson at alarson@cooklib.org. DROP IN
Abandoning her abusive fiancé in 1943 New York to enlist with the Red Cross and head to Europe, Irene Woodward befriends Dorothy Dunford as they join the Allied soldiers streaming into France after D-Day. As they become embroiled in danger, from the Battle of the Bulge to the liberation of Buchenwald, Irene learns to trust again through friendship.

The Cook Memorial Public Library District serves communities in northern Lake County, Illinois: Libertyville, Green Oaks, Vernon Hills, Indian Creek, Mettawa, and parts of Mundelein.
